- Historical Background: Issued by the Royal Thai Mint, the 10 Baht coin pays homage to King Rama X, who ascended to the throne in 2016. This coin series, minted during his reign, symbolizes continuity and respect for the Thai monarchy.
- Design Features: The obverse of the coin displays a portrait of King Rama X with the Thai inscription "มหาวชิราลงกรณ รัชกาลที่ ๑๐" (His Majesty King Rama X). On the reverse side, the denomination "10 บาท" (10 Baht) and "ประเทศไทย" (Thailand) are inscribed. The combination of a central Aluminium-Bronze disc and a Copper-Nickel ring adds a unique visual appeal to the coin.
- Technical Specifications: The Thailand 10 Baht coin weighs 8.50g and has a diameter of 26.00mm. Its bi-metallic composition of Aluminium-Bronze and Copper-Nickel enhances its durability while adding a distinct two-tone appearance.
